This novella was like a balm for my soul! It was so sweet and adorable with no angst and sometimes you just need that. I giggled so much reading this, especially all the subtle innuendos.
I loved both Boone and Wylie and how they complimented each other perfectly. Boone was a man who took care of everyone else but never let himself be on the receiving end and Wylie was a man that just wanted to find somewhere he would belong and he found it on Rainbow Ranch. The found family and acceptance were beautiful. Everyone got to be their authentic selves.
As with every other book I’ve read by M.A. Wardell the spice was top tier! And I just love when a character is obsessed with a dimple or freckles and this one had that and I couldn’t stop smiling whenever it was mentioned. Can’t wait to read the other novellas in this series and I hope Dennis appears in them as well because he is a hoot!
